This paper presents research for developing a virtual inspection system that evaluates the dimensional tolerance of forged aerofoil blades formed using the finite element (FE) method. Conventional algorithms adopted by modern coordinate measurement processes have been incorporated with the latest free-form surface evaluation techniques to provide a robust framework for the dimensional inspection of FE aerofoil models. The accuracy of the approach had been verified with a strong correlation obtained between the virtual inspection data and coordinate measurement data from corresponding aerofoil components.

Aim: Intrauterine, early life and maternal exposures may have important consequences for cancer development in later life. The aim of this study was to examine perinatal and birth characteristics with respect to Cutaneous malignant melanoma (CMM) risk. Methods: The Northern Ireland Child Health System database was used to examine gestational age adjusted birth weight, infant feeding practices, parental age and socioeconomic factors at birth in relation to CMM risk amongst 447,663 infants delivered between January 1971 and December 1986. Follow-up of histologically verified CMM cases was undertaken from the beginning of 1993 to 31st December 2007. Multivariable adjusted unconditional logistic regression was used to calculate odds ratios (OR) and 95% confidence intervals (CI) of CMM risk. Results: A total of 276 CMM cases and 440,336 controls contributed to the final analysis. In reference to normal (gestational age-adjusted) weight babies, those heaviest at birth were twice as likely to develop CMM OR 2.4 (95% CI 1.1-5.1).
